The word life is a common noun. Any common noun can be a proper noun if it is used as a name or a title. Examples: Life is Beautiful (1997), It's a Wonderful Life (1946), or the Word of Life Fellowship.

No, the noun 'life' is a common noun, a general word for the period of time between the birth and death of someone or something; a word for any life of anyone or anything.A proper noun is the name of title of a specific person, place, or thing; for example, Life (brand) cereal or New York Life Insurance Company.
